Who Benefits from a Week-long Van Journey?
From young professionals seeking social freedom, adventure-seekers craving authentic landscapes, to families longing for unhurried connection—anyone can use a van to travel smarter. Local economies benefit too, as van travelers spend on supplies, camping fees, and small services that strengthen communities.
Travel trends in the U.S. today reflect a shift toward intentional journeys—spending time off the beaten path, avoiding crowded tourist hubs, and experiencing local life without luxury cost tags. The van offers a practical solution: living simply on the road while exploring national parks, small towns, and scenic byways.
